The opportunity

EY is has an opportunity for you as an experienced compensation professional to develop and drive compensation programs, including base compensation, variable pay and recognition programs. You will provide compensation consulting services to various stakeholders across the firm. You will be responsible for key compensation functions including market analysis, survey participation; assisting with the design and development of base salary and variable pay compensation plans and programs, compensation education/training and other consulting services.

Your key responsibilities

You will serve as a compensation consultant by:

  • Assist in development and execution of pay programs that are market competitive and recognize and drive performance
  • Manage compensation related projects.
  • Interpret and advise on compensation policies and procedures.
  • Analyze market data and internal salary data to provide customized job analysis
  • Research and develop recommendations for design, communication, implementation and administration of base salary and variable pay compensation programs, practices, polices and systems which are aligned with firm philosophies and strategies.
  • Manage year-end compensation for designate business practices
  • Monitor trends in base pay and variable pay compensation and recommends enhancements that will aid in retention, motivation, and recruitment of talent.
  • Recommend updates to compensation practices, merit budgets and salary range structures based on the research and analysis of salary surveys and other available competitive information sources to maintain a competitive compensation program.
  • Manage the review, analysis, evaluation of job descriptions based on job responsibility using established evaluation systems to determine salary grades.
  • Apply knowledge of compensation policies and procedures and compensation legislation to make sure firm polices, practices and programs comply with legal standards
